Tyra Mae Steele Claims WWE Released Her After Winning Amateur Wrestling Gold

TLDR

Tyra Mae Steele claims WWE released her after she competed in an Olympic-style wrestling event on a weekend off and won gold with a $350,000 prize purse. According to Steele's March 12, 2026 Twitter post, WWE moved her up to Raw when she returned the following Monday, only to inform her they were letting her go because she went behind their back. Steele, who won the first season of WWE LFG in June 2025 and is known outside wrestling as Olympic gold medalist Tamyra Mensah-Stock, had her last WWE match in February 2026 when she challenged for the Evolve Women's Championship.
